Output 352e07fbdc9ca64de87626a3a3df3d92225e1159da5525242c5e6ab9c1902686:1

value
17453162
script pubkey
OP_0 OP_PUSHBYTES_20 ec986b8f92adb715927e9ac424f85827b51c6dea
address
bc1qajvxhruj4km3tyn7ntzzf7zcy763cm023gag67
transaction
352e07fbdc9ca64de87626a3a3df3d92225e1159da5525242c5e6ab9c1902686
confirmations
277221
spent
true